How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Selma?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Selma Luxury Studio Apartments | $1,074 | $788 | $1,230 |
| Selma Luxury 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,204 | $446 | $2,174 |
| Selma Luxury 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,484 | $916 | $2,225 |
| Selma Luxury 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,929 | $1,285 | $2,986 |
| Selma Luxury 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,145 | $1,995 | $2,295 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Selma
How much are Studio apartments in Selma?
There are currently 20 Studio Apartments in Selma with rent ranges from $788 to $1,230 with an average price of $1,074.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Selma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Selma ranges from $446 to $2,174 with an average monthly rent of $1,204.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Selma c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Selma range from $916 to $2,225.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,484.
How expensive are Selma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 72 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Selma on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,285 to $2,986 - averaging $1,929 for the location.
